> > Here is an interesting project I heard about recently on FLOSS Weekly.
> http://grano.la/ The idea is to power down your PC/Servers when they are
> not in use. According to the blurb and project leads it does this
> differently to current power saving methods which are based on your current
> usage. This apparently uses some clever algorithms to predict your usage and
> scale up your processor in advance, so preventing any lag.
